So rude!!! Had unknown debt with Comcast, sent to collections 5 years after account was closed. Found out from stellar. Told me I owe $382.48, $192.48 from my final bill snt 30-45 days after cancellation. This amount is way to high, especially when monthly bills were only $70. The other $190 was said to be for eqipment that Comcast claims wasn't returned. It was picked up by tech. Contacted Comcast, they have a debt for 192.48 and have no idea what the $190 is for. The amount I owe is broken down $120 for cable box, $40 for modem, and 32.48 for my final bill. Stellar refuses to accept this, once I told them I had a bill from the company, suds he got defensive and said they just make up amounts or charge extra and got really defensive. Tried giving me a settlement for $308 and then told me I need to take care of my bills and pay them!  The next day, I was contacted by stellar saying Comcast adjusted the total and removed the $190. But Comcast says that the $192.48 includes the eqipment, so why would they say the $190 is for eqipment when the total of the eqipment doesn't even equal TNT amount. I was yelled at and never listened to. I don't feel comfortable paying an amount that s incorrect. I am talking with Comcast daily to get this resolved so I can get the debt paid and removed from my credit report. So rude and frustrating!!!

    Get an attorney. You may be able to sue them for violations of FDCPA, and it doesn't sound like you will resolve this fairly any other way.  You might be able to use potential FDCPA damages as leverage to encourage removal from your credit report.

    1)  Billing you for  amounts not owed (deceptive collection)
    2)  Harassing, yelling at you, belittling you  (abusive collection)
    3)  Failure to send "g" letter within 5 days (you never mentioned receiving any letter)

    You can find a consumer attorney through www.naca.net
